Most will recommend an LR atty (you've tried that). You
could increase nic content, but that could be bad if you're already getting your cravings curbed by whatever you're using now and induce a new set of problems like headaches from nic overload. Increasing the PG in your e-liquid will help both with taste & throat hit with the inverse result of less vapor production, which in my opinion isn't a big deal anyway. Shoot for 80% PG or so.
A higher voltage setup would give you a great boost. Even a 3.7v Riva battery or 3.8v kGo would give you more at little expense versus your ~3.2-3.4v eGo. Even if cost is an issue, you could get a
Maxi Roughstack or
Shine Mod with some of these
batteries for some 6v action, but you'll need to use either ~3.0ohm cartos or dual-coils for that much voltage. You could do a box mod like
this and get a nice 5v vape if 6v is too "hot".
All these recommendations are ~$50USD, & will definitely give you more kick. I feel your pain, my tastebuds are pretty shot as well & it wasn't until I tried a high voltage setup that I started really loving vaping.
